Methodology

How the analysis is actually built

The platform follows a fixed four-stage process. Each stage is auditable, and none of them removes the need for human judgement at the point of decision.

  1. 01

    Ingestion

    Raw feeds from connected exchanges are pulled continuously, preserving source metadata for later verification.

  2. 02

    Normalisation

    Differing formats, currencies and reporting intervals are aligned into one consistent structure before analysis begins.

  3. 03

    Neural Analysis

    Pattern-recognition models assess correlations and volatility signals across the normalised dataset, producing probability ranges rather than fixed predictions.

  4. 04

    Optimisation

    Findings are translated into ranked, contextual recommendations that a person can accept, adjust or decline.

The system is designed to inform, not to instruct. Every recommendation is presented with its underlying confidence level, so the person making the decision can weigh the model's output against their own knowledge of their circumstances, obligations and risk tolerance.

How current is the data shown on the dashboard?

Connected exchange feeds are ingested continuously. Latency depends on what each exchange's own API permits, but the platform is built to reflect new data as soon as it becomes available rather than on a fixed refresh cycle.

Which exchanges are compatible with the platform?

Vind meer uit is built to integrate with multiple exchanges through standard data feeds. Compatibility depends on the specific exchange's API access, which is confirmed on a case-by-case basis during onboarding.

What is the reasoning behind the predictive models?

The models analyse historical volatility, correlation between instruments, and current market conditions to produce probability-weighted scenarios. They are not designed to predict a single outcome, but to indicate a range of plausible outcomes and the confidence associated with each.

Does the AI make decisions on our behalf?

No. The platform produces ranked recommendations and supporting data. The decision to act, adjust or decline remains with the person or household using the platform.
